About Us
SLCN Therapy is a family-centred allied health organisation providing evidence-based early intervention and therapy services to children aged 0–18 and their families. Our team includes speech therapists, behaviour therapists, developmental educators, and admin staff—all working together to make a meaningful difference.
We’re proud of our positive team culture, our commitment to professional development, and our focus on empowering families through collaborative care.
The Role
As a Therapy Assistant, you’ll support children and families to build independence, confidence, and participation in everyday life. Working closely with therapists and families, you’ll help implement therapy plans tailored to each child’s unique needs.
Your responsibilities will include:
Delivering engaging, evidence-based interventions aligned with family goals
Supporting therapy in everyday routines and community settings
Collaborating with therapists, families, and other professionals
Monitoring and reviewing progress with the team and families
Promoting inclusion and participation in community activities
Contributing to continuous improvement through feedback and training
What We’re Looking For
Certificate IV in Allied Health Assistance or current student in an Allied Health degree
A genuine passion for working with children and families
Strong communication and interpersonal skills
Ability to make therapy fun, meaningful, and family-centred
Required compliance:
Working with Children Check
National Police Check
NDIS Worker Screening Check
Driver’s licence and access to a vehicle
